The French national team, led by Didier Deschamps (though not present on the bench today), achieved a resounding victory against Norway. The star of the match was the Ballon d’Or recipient, Ousmane Dembélé, who scored a remarkable hat-trick. Further contributing to the win was a goal from Antoine Doué. The French goalkeeper, Mike Maignan, also played a crucial role by saving a penalty, preventing Norway from narrowing the scoreline.

In another fixture, Senegal delivered a dominant performance, defeating Iraq with a commanding 5-0 scoreline. This impressive win puts Senegal in a strong position as they aim for third place in their competition.

Notably, Erling Haaland, the prolific Norwegian striker, was a spectator during his team’s match against France. The article also hints at a surprising tactical decision made by Norway’s coach, Ståle Solbakken.
